How they compare
SDG: Europe and Northern America currently reports 24.61 million against 294,521 in Belarus, a difference of 24.31 million.
That makes SDG: Europe and Northern America's figure about 83.6 times Belarus's.
Across all 26 years both countries report, SDG: Europe and Northern America has been ahead every year.
Belarus ranks 93rd and SDG: Europe and Northern America ranks 90th of 220 countries.
SDG: Europe and Northern America has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belarus | SDG: Europe and Northern America |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 423,848 | 27.91 million | 27.48 million | SDG: Europe and Northern America |
| 2000s | 330,942 | 25.98 million | 25.65 million | SDG: Europe and Northern America |
| 2010s | 233,268 | 22.70 million | 22.47 million | SDG: Europe and Northern America |
| 2020s | 274,771 | 24.22 million | 23.94 million | SDG: Europe and Northern America |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
